Leibniz

This is a biography of Gottfried Wilhelm Leibniz, one of the most important figures in the history of philosophy. He was a prominent German polymath and philosopher in the history of mathematics and the history of philosophy. Leibniz developed the ideas of differential and integral calculus, independently of Isaac Newton. His notation has been in general use ever since it was published.

Leibniz also made major contributions to physics and technology, and he anticipated notions that surfaced much later in probability theory, topology, psychology, linguistics, and information science. His philosophical positions are often identified as belonging to the rationalist school. Leibniz also contributed to the field of library science.
